The Phosphoric Acid Fuel Cell (PAFC) Market is witnessing steady growth as the demand for clean and efficient energy solutions continues to rise. Phosphoric Acid Fuel Cells (PAFCs) are a type of fuel cell that use liquid phosphoric acid as an electrolyte to generate electricity through an electrochemical reaction between hydrogen and oxygen.

PAFCs are known for their high reliability, long lifespan, and suitability for stationary power generation and combined heat and power (CHP) applications. With the increasing emphasis on reducing greenhouse gas emissions, energy efficiency, and sustainable power generation, the PAFC market is poised for expansion across various industrial and commercial sectors.

Market Drivers

Growing Demand for Clean Energy: Increasing awareness of climate change and environmental sustainability is driving the adoption of PAFCs. These fuel cells provide a cleaner alternative to conventional fossil fuel-based power generation by producing electricity with minimal emissions.

Government Policies and Incentives: Various countries are promoting fuel cell technologies through subsidies, tax incentives, and grants. Supportive regulations encourage the deployment of PAFC systems for stationary power generation, combined heat and power, and backup power applications.

Industrial and Commercial Power Applications: PAFCs are widely used in industrial facilities, hospitals, hotels, and office buildings for continuous and reliable power supply. The ability to generate both electricity and heat makes PAFCs highly attractive for combined heat and power (CHP) systems.

Reliability and Long Lifespan: PAFCs offer high durability and reliability compared to other fuel cell technologies. Their stable operation under harsh conditions makes them suitable for commercial and industrial power applications where continuous energy supply is critical.

Technological Advancements in Fuel Cell Systems: Innovations in PAFC design, materials, and stack efficiency are enhancing performance and reducing operational costs, further driving adoption in stationary and commercial power markets.

Technology Advancement

Improved Electrolyte and Membrane Technology: Advances in phosphoric acid electrolyte formulations and electrode designs are improving ionic conductivity and reducing corrosion, enhancing the overall efficiency and durability of PAFC systems.

Higher Power Density and Efficiency: Modern PAFC systems are designed to deliver higher power output while maintaining energy efficiency. Improved stack designs and optimized fuel cell configurations contribute to better performance in commercial and industrial applications.

Integration with Renewable Energy: PAFCs are increasingly being integrated with renewable energy systems, such as solar and wind, to provide reliable backup power and continuous energy supply, bridging the gap between intermittent renewable generation and demand.

Advanced Monitoring and Control Systems: Intelligent monitoring and control technologies allow for real-time tracking of temperature, pressure, and electrical output, ensuring optimal operation, predictive maintenance, and enhanced safety of PAFC systems.

Reduced Operational Costs: Technological innovations in heat recovery, stack materials, and system design are contributing to lower operational and maintenance costs, making PAFCs more economically viable for commercial deployment.
